The big event at the RAC Arena in Perth, Australia, had a few surprises in store, including a great first-round result in the co-main event, where Kai Kara-France defeated Steve Erceg by TKO. There was also a not so pleasant surprise when judge Howie Booth announced a confusing 30-27 result in favor of Tai Tuivasa, even though the general consensus was that Jairzinho Rozenstruik had easily defeated “Bam Bam.”
